    Rodrigo Mendoza will miss out after picking up his fifth yellow card of the season last time out. Nico Gonzalez has picked up a muscle injury, so he's ruled out, while Pablo Barris is a doubt for Atletico.Atletico Madrid have seen under 2.5 goals in 9 of their last 11 home matches against Espanyol in all competitions.

    • Last season's Scottish Cup finalists - Aberdeen and Celtic - meet for the third (and potentially final) time in the Scottish Premiership this season in Wednesday night's slightly later kick-off. Aberdeen's 6-2 win over Livingston was the first time that they had scored six or more goals in a Scottish Premiership match since May 2017, where they beat Partick Thistle 6-0. However, their hard work from the Livi victory was undone by a capitulation in Kilmarnock, where the Dons were defeated by three goals without reply. Having lost both league meetings with the Hoops so far this season, they are up against it here. Celtic head to Pittodrie having leapfrogged bitter rivals Rangers into second place in the Scottish Premiership table, with both the Bhoys and the Gers six points behind league leaders Hearts who are in action on Tuesday night.
